seniorAndroid

What is Paging 3?

Updated Feb 20, 2026

Short answer

Paging 3 loads large datasets efficiently in chunks, reducing memory usage and improving performance.

Deep explanation

🔹 Problem

Loading large data → memory issues

---

🔹 Solution

Paging:

  • Loads data page by page
  • Supports remote + local data

---

🖼️

Markdown
![Paging 3](https://developer.android.com/static/topic/libraries/architecture/images/paging3.png)

---

🔹 System Insight

  • Used in feeds (Instagram, Twitter)
  • Handles infinite scrolling

---

🔹 Performance Insight

  • Reduces memory footprint
  • Faster UI rendering

Unlock with a Pro subscription to view this section.

View pricing

Real-world example

No real-world example available yet.

Unlock with a Pro subscription to view this section.

Upgrade to Pro

Common mistakes

No common mistakes listed yet.

Unlock with a Pro subscription to view this section.

Upgrade to Pro

Follow-up questions

No follow-up questions available yet.

Unlock with a Pro subscription to view this section.

Upgrade to Pro

More Android interview questions

View all →